Banamau Population - Hardoi, Uttar Pradesh

Banamau is a large village located in Sawayajpur Tehsil of Hardoi district, Uttar Pradesh with total 473 families residing. The Banamau village has population of 3160 of which 1703 are males while 1457 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Banamau village population of children with age 0-6 is 411 which makes up 13.01 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Banamau village is 856 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Banamau as per census is 1065,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Banamau village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Banamau village was 73.48 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Banamau Male literacy stands at 84.18 % while female literacy rate was 60.56 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 12.91 % of total population in Banamau village. The village Banamau curr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Banamau village out of total population, 1113 were engaged in work activities. 73.76 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 26.24 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1113 workers engaged in Main Work, 545 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 161 were Agricultural labourer.
